Dallas, TX (April 1, 2024): This April, join EarthxTV to celebrate Earth Month on the only network dedicated to sustainability and conservation. EarthxTV is celebrating Earth Day every day with special programming blocks and the return of two popular series—”Bike to Bites” on April 4 at 9 pm E.T. and “Kill Your Lawn” on April 11 at 10 pm E.T. Both series will air on EarthxTV in the U.S., the U.K., Ireland, and Europe. Kill Your Lawn (Season 2, April 11 at 10 pm E.T.) Joey Santore and Al Scorch are on a mission to kill your lawn. This season on Kill Your Lawn the wise-cracking duo travel to Chicago and Washington D.C., upturning the status quo, one lawn-killing adventure at a time. Join Joey and Al as they help homeowners completely transform their front lawns. Removing water-hungry sod and replacing it with native plants is serious business; it can: ● Increase biodiversity, including native birds, insects, and pollinators ● Reduce landfill waste ● Decrease pesticide use ● Save water and help prevent erosion and flooding Chicago native Joey Santore, also known for his popular Crime Pays But Art Doesn’t YouTube channel, has a passion for native plants. The former freight train conductor and self-taught botanist travels the globe documenting plant life, evolution, and ecology. He also enjoys fuzzy slippers, fine marinara sauce, and taquerias with numerous health code violations. His co-host, friend, and fellow Chicago native Al Scorch is a comedian, writer, and musician. Whether he’s releasing albums of original songs, or producing videos for his own YouTube channel “Over By There,” Al is Joey’s sounding board and on-the-fly narrator as they travel the country, upturning the status quo, one lawn killing adventure at a time. Bike to Bites (Season 2, April 4 at 9pm E.T.) Join host Garrett Bess for all-new adventures as he bikes across the U.S. and visits Philadelphia, Chicago, Austin, Boulder, San Diego, and other cities to explore spectacular sights and flavors while showcasing sustainable, locally sourced, farm-to-table dishes and earth-friendly restaurants. From Italian Ice shops and breweries to Michelin-starred restaurants, join Garrett as he spotlights the best places in town. This season Garrett visits celebrity Chef David Burke’s DRIFTHOUSE on the Jersey Shore, Pat’s King of Steaks in Philadelphia, Zahav and multi-James Beard and Four Bells awarded chef Michael Solomonov, Mr. Beef in Chicago which inspired the TV series “The Bear,” and many more.
